About this plant
Monarda didyma 'Gardenview Scarlet', commonly known as Bee Balm, is a show-stopping perennial cherished for its brilliant, shaggy scarlet-red flowers that create a spectacular display from mid-summer through early fall. Its unique, tubular blooms are a magnet for local pollinators, making it an excellent choice for a vibrant and wildlife-friendly garden. Beyond its stunning aesthetics, 'Gardenview Scarlet' is a remarkably resilient and easy-to-grow plant. Its upright, clumping habit makes it suitable for borders, mixed perennial beds, or even meadow plantings, adding a burst of color and texture wherever it's placed. This cultivar is also known for its excellent mildew resistance, ensuring a healthier and more attractive plant throughout the growing season. Care & maintenance
Easily grown in average, moist, well-drained soils. Drought tolerant once established. Deadhead spent blooms to encourage more flowering and prevent self-seeding. Divide clumps every 2-3 years in spring to maintain vigor and prevent overcrowding. Good air circulation helps prevent powdery mildew.
